The CSD16414Q5 is a high-performance power MOSFET (Metal-Oxide-Semiconductor Field-Effect Transistor) manufactured by Texas Instruments. It is designed for applications requiring efficient power management, such as in DC-DC converters, power supplies, and motor control systems.
